How Sunscreens Work

To choose the best sunscreen for yourself and your children, it is important to understand how these products work. There are two main active ingredient categories in sunscreen:
1. Mineral UV Filters : Zinc Oxide or Titanium Dioxide
2. Chemical UV Filters: Oxybenzone, Octinoxate, Homosalate, Octisalate, Octocrylene
You will always want to choose the mineral UV filters, so flip over the package and see what the active ingredient is at the top. In addition to choosing a mineral UV filter, you will also want to check for other toxic ingredients such as PEG’s, Fragrances (hidden ingredients), Retinyl Pamitate, and more. Sun Safety For Babies and Kids

  • Infants and babies under the age of 1 should not use sunscreen. Hats, rash guards, and shade are recommended for Infants instead of sunscreen.
  • Rash Guards for kids are a great idea and limit the amount of sunscreen needed.

 THE WORST SUNSCREENS

  • The chemical found in these sunscreens, oxybenzone is an allergen. It is absorbed quickly through the skin in high amounts. Oxybenzone been found in breastmilk, amniotic fluid, urine, and blood. It is also a potential endocrine disruptor. Not only do these products contain oxybenzone, they also contain a wide variety of other potentially dangerous chemicals.
  • Higher SPF does not mean better protection!
  • Spray sunscreens seem to have worse ingredients. I would recommend sticking to a lotion if possible.
  • Off brand products seemed to score worse, specifically CVS brand and Walgreen’s. I would stay away from all of their sunscreens!
  • Products marketed to kids and babies are not exempt from having terrible ingredients.

The Safest Sunscreens


  • Under active ingredients you should see zinc oxide or titanium dioxide. These are considered mineral sunscreens.
  • The ingredient lists are not as scary, and WAY shorter as opposed to the worst sunscreens.
  • There ARE mineral sunscreens that still contain toxic ingredients so check those labels.
  • Some can come off as white, and need a bit more rubbing in, but the reward of not using dangerous chemicals is worth it to me.
  • Generally they are not fragranced which is a positive because the word “fragrance” on an ingredient label could include over 1500 different hidden chemicals.
